Polytechnic School Kindergarten Celebrates 100 Days of Learning



Polytechnic School’s Kindergarten class recently celebrated the milestone of 100 days of school with a series of engaging activities. Students marked the occasion by coloring festive headwear, counting and stringing necklaces made of 100 pieces of dry cereal, and decorating imaginative “100th-day monsters.” They also participated in a dice-rolling game to chart how long it would take to reach 100 and shared their predictions about life at age 100. Their responses included aspirations such as visiting grandchildren, staying healthy, taking naps, and attending 100 football games.
